Based on all of these factors, we compiled this list of the best callus removers on the market. When looking for a callus remover, look for chemical or manual abrasion. Chemical abrasion is when the remover uses an acid-based active ingredient like salicylic acid to exfoliate the skin. Meanwhile, manual abrasion uses scrubs or devices. Callus remover tips

It’s possible that your callus is actually a wart, in which case these treatments won’t help (and could actually introduce more problems). Pregnant women should not use salicylic acid treatments, says Dr. Campbell, though she notes these products are usually safe for breastfeeding women. Electric callus removers feature a roller head covered with a sandpaper-like material. As you roll it over your calluses, the roller head gently buffs away the dead, hard skin to reveal the smooth, healthy skin beneath.Calluses are hardened areas of skin caused by increased friction and pressure. Some cordless models utilise built-in batteries that require charging, so you must plug them into an outlet for a certain period to recharge. Other cordless callus removers utilise traditional batteries that require replacement when they are fully drained. A. Using a callus remover usually isn’t dangerous if you are gentle and don’t remove too much skin. However, if your calluses are extremely painful or you have diabetes, it’s a good idea to see a dermatologist, podiatrist, or orthopedist first. With an electric remover, you usually must replace the roller head every two to four months, depending on how often you use it.
